Answer:

The function [tex]f(x)[/tex] gets shifted 5 units up to form the function g(x).

Step-by-step explanation:

As the parent function is given by

[tex]f(x) = x[/tex]

And the resulting function

[tex]g(x) = x+ 5[/tex]

When a constant 'c' is added to the output of the function, the function is shifted 'c' units up.

[tex]g(x) = f(x)+b[/tex]

Here, a constant '5' is added to the output of the function, so the function is shifted '5' units up.

Therefore, the function [tex]f(x)[/tex] gets shifted 5 units up to form the function g(x).
